Types of Drug Detox Programs in Mount Gay, West Virginia

There are many various types of alcohol and drug detox centers. The program you enroll into, therefore, will greatly depend on the substance(s) you used to abuse and the spectrum of the symptoms of withdrawal you are likely to experience when you abruptly stop using alcohol and drugs.

Consider the following:

1. Inpatient Detox

In a lot of instances, you will find that residential or inpatient detoxification in Mount Gay is the most ideal form of rehab because it can assist you in avoiding relapse as well as ensure that you have round the clock medical support, oversight, and management in case your withdrawal is considered a medical emergency.

Today, the majority of detox services are offered on an inpatient or residential basis. Once you complete these programs, you might also transfer to another drug and alcohol abuse rehabilitation program if the center you detoxed in does not offer treatment services.

2. Outpatient Detoxification

Outpatient detoxification is hardly ever recommended. However, it may be an option if your drug and alcohol addiction is not ass serious, if finances are a problem, or if you cannot leave home/work because of your daily commitments. Either way, this form of addiction treatment will require you to check-in on a regular basis with the detoxification staff.

You may also be administered drugs through prescriptions or at a methadone clinic when you require more intensive oversight during the detox process. In the end, however, outpatient detox rarely works quite as effectively as that offered on an inpatient or residential basis.

Overall, certain intoxicating substances may come with some physical symptoms of withdrawal but also cause more severe psychological withdrawal. Such drugs include cocaine, methamphetamines, and other stimulants. In these cases, the detoxification process should also have a therapeutic and psychiatric component to ensure better management and treatment for these psychological conditions. You might also receive 24/7 oversight to make sure that you do not harm yourself or other people.
